Conceived as a metaphorical passage, The Doors invites audiences to step into several individual artistic worlds from various artists & nationalities. Each “door” opens onto a unique way of seeing, thinking, and making: from personal narratives and cultural memory to formal experimentation and imaginative abstraction. 

 

Through this structure, the exhibition does not ask the viewer to compare or rank the artists, but to encounter each on their own terms. At the same time, The Door is dedicated to positioning these artists on a broader, international stage.  The exhibition acts as a point of access for new audiences, collectors, and institutions internationally. The artworks propose not a single story of contemporary art, but parallel ones — coexisting and enriching one another.
